I'll try version 6.4 and report back.Udderdude wrote: Have to agree, this game definitely doesn't out-CAVE CAVE.In fact quite a few boss shot patterns and enemy movements seem taken right out of CAVE games. The few original shot patterns I saw weren't all that great, although a few were pretty cool. The scoring seemed like a bunch of different CAVE scoring systems stitched together. I'm not entirely sure it works .. it's really easy to keep your hit counter going though.
Don't know why you say it only has 3 levels though, the one I downloaded has 5. Although the 4th level feels like it could have been removed completely and the game would be better for it. The two minibosses and the boss are all exactly the same and have the same shot patterns, except that more shots are fired for each version. Pretty lazy .. level 5 was definitely the best out of the entire game.

Yep, version 6.4 has 5 stages. Couldn't agree more on what you said about the last two levels. Not only do the graphics get really good in level 5 (level 4 at least has a different theme from lv. 1-3), plenty of mode 7 shit, but there's also lots of action (dude shamelessly rips off Mushihimesama and ESPrade etc.) and the music gets kinda bearable.
One thing I really think could have been improved on is/ are the many breaks in the flow when there's nothing happening for 6 seconds or so and you begin wondering whether the game has frozen. Nevertheless, despite its flaws, it's still a neat little game. I guess I'll play a credit now and again in the future.
